Suspended driver arrested with drugs and a glass pipe

A Davenport man was arrested on drug charges after being stopped with narcotics and a glass pipe.

An officer stopped a Ford Excursion for a cracked windshield violation at Rolling Acres Road and U.S. Hwy. 27/441 around 7:45 p.m. Tuesday, according to an arrest report from the Lady Lake Police Department. He then learned that the driver, 45-year-old Matthew Barr Young, had a suspended license for failure to pay a traffic fine.

A K-9 unit subsequently responded to the scene and asked if there was anything illegal inside the vehicle. Young handed over a clear cellophane wrapper with two grams of marijuana. He and the passenger did not possess medical marijuana licenses, the report said.

They were asked to exit the vehicle as the officers began to search it. Law enforcement found a burnt marijuana cigarette on the dashboard, two clear plastic baggies with 4 grams of methamphetamine on the floorboard, and a glass “bubble” pipe with residue, the report said…
